The Seductress consists of two panels. Five headless female bodies intertwine and overlap, appearing playful, faceless, and boneless, forming a gender-fluid, flesh-and-blood body landscape. Through the communication of the body itself, the work creates a dialogue of beauty and desire.
Qiuxiang Liu (Rainy Tong) is a London-based painter (b. 1986, China) who holds an MA in Painting from the Royal College of Art. Her practice centers on the female body and spans painting, sculpture, installation, performance, and poetry.
In July 2025, Rainy held her solo exhibition With Rainy Eyes at RuptureXIBIT in London, following her first solo show, While Repeating I Love You, Nothing Will Die! in July 2022 in Shenzhen, China. She has also participated in various residencies and group exhibitions in London and beyond.
Rainy paints the female body in bold entanglements, exploring themes of beauty, gender and identity fluidity. Her current practice is inspired by the poetic act of blossoming, creating a playfulscapes by constructing the female body in poetic, erotic, vibrant ways—delving into the adventure, mystery, and rupture embedded within. Through exploring the body itself, Rainy is moving toward abstraction and material exploration. Her work challenges traditional social norms and seeking to liberate the female body from its fixed position in history and mainstream culture, making the invisible visible.
